The Ministry of Ports, Shipping, and Waterways, under the Sagarmala Programme, intends to create an ecosystem for the development of Ro-Ro (Roll-on, Roll-off) ferries and waterway ...

The Ministry of Ports, Shipping, and Waterways, under the Sagarmala Programme, intends to create an ecosystem for the development of Ro-Ro (Roll-on, Roll-off) ferries and waterway transportation throughout the nation. When compared to traditional modes of transportation, this method of transportation offers a number of advantages, including shorter travel distances, cheaper logistics, and less pollution.

The draft guidelines aim to standardise and streamline the development and operation of ferry services, as well as, promote ease of doing business by reducing delays and conflicts, Additionally, guidelines will aid in boosting private players' confidence, hence expanding their involvement and encouraging healthy competition in such ventures.

The draft of Guidelines for Operationalization of Ro-Ro and Ro-Pax ferry service along the coast of India is issued for public consultation for seeking feedback and suggestions.

Click here to read the policy document. (PDF 1,230KB)

The last date of submission is July 6, 2022.

We should engage a project consultant to conduct feasibility study for all identified routes to confirm the projects. Then we should engage project consultants to conduct Front End Engineering Design, assess project costs and Risk assessments. Then we should go for Public private partnership to implement the project. The company which takes this project should prepare HSEIA and obtain environmental clearances and execute the project engaging engineering consultants and construction contractors for the jetty and port infrastructure for berthing Ro-Ro and Ro-Pax vessels. It will be better to have inland waterways terminals created by dredging and reclamation since this will avoid long jetties and provides more secured access control system. Chip embedded adhar cards plus eye scanners can be used at ascending /descending points for secured access control by port authority. Vessel operators can be any third party fulfils the requirmets of vessel construction,maint,operation& certification.

1)Monitor &test frequently the atmosphere in Ro-Ro spaces for engines exhaust in compartment to prevent CO concentration from exceeding allowable limits. 2)Identify problem areas of roro vessels- stability design while shifting cargo or putting at higher levels, hull failure leading to flooding causing capsize, cargo access doors should not be used as ramp-check for damages to avoid ingress of water, uneven cargo distribution, Unsecured cargo, Enough sub division to contain fire or ingress of water, Location of life saving appliances, cargo access door should not be near water line. 3) Availability of Emergency Towing arrangements like Tug and tow wires. 4)Loading condition must be calculated for intact stability, shearing force, bending /torsion moment,etc & should not exceed 80% at any time. 5)Over stowage should be avoided. Cargo planning should be done as per latest cargo I.e. cargo for later port shouldn’t be placed over that of earlier port. 6)Put penalty for any non-compliance.
